Would the GTS250 play this game well with most settings maxed, minus shadowing?

I seriously think it would have to do with how fast the CPU of the computer is, how much RAM the computer has and whether or not the OS is Windows XP (32 bit OS ) or Windows 7 ( 64 bit OS )

and also a determining factor would be how fine tuned the OS is overall ( how many processes is running that should not be running unless absolutely needed )

What you have here would run AH just fine.  Without OC, should be able to run full sliders, high res, 1024, detailed, and shadows on self.  Others shadows might be possible depending on how clean the owner keeps the computer.

Any chance you can squeeze an extra 50 bucks and end up with a GTX260 or equivalent?

Would the GTS250 play this game well with most settings maxed, minus shadowing?

From what I understand, the GTS250 is the same thing as the 9800GTX+.
I run the 9800GTX+ with a 2.7GHZ C2D, and 4GB of DDR3 ram with Win 7.  Everything maxed out, 1024 textures, 1920X1200 resolution, all sliders set to maximum, and all options on EXCEPT for all shadow options (which is turned off).

I see 60FPS over 90-95% of the time.  I RARELY see less than 55FPS, and I think I've seen it drop below 50FPS just a few times for a split second (during FSO takeoffs).
